Description

E.E.A. on the cover, Evelyn Elizabeth Countess of Ancaster, daughter of the Marquis of Huntly.

Has small mounted photographs and larger prints, including:

The Countess of Ancaster, her husband, the Earl at first the Hon. Gilbert Heathcote, and their young children.

1, 14 the Countess in an assembly of small pictures.

16 the Earl in an assembly of small pictures.

17 with babies

18, 20 Hon. Gilbert

21 children

42 Hon. G. with shooting party

44 group at croquet

47 Hon. G. with shooting party

75 Hon. G.

77 children
